Omega Camera is a sample camera app based on modern Android application tech-stacks and CameraX API.
Soon in Google Play...
- Minimum SDK level 21
- CameraX API - the library that makes it easier to add camera capabilities to your app.
- Kotlin based + Coroutines for asynchronous.
- JetPack
- Lifecycle - dispose of observing data when lifecycle state changes.
- Navigation component - represents all app's navigation paths.
- Glide - loading images.
- TransformationLayout - implementing transformation motion animations.
- Material-Components - Material design components like ripple animation, cardView.
- Custom Views
- RangeSeekBar - A simple way to implement a nice vertical range seekbar.
- ResizeableViewPager - Custom implementation of classic ViewPager with pinch-to-zoom feature.
Follow me for my next creations!